Turns out revenue model design is important. And it’s a product matter first. With the three examples presented here I also want to explore the idea that success in digital is not driven by the adoption of a specific business model, but by the ability to monetise a product or ecosystem in different ways — or, in other words, to implement a multimodal business model.
